I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Requêtes et SQL. Discussion :

Comment faire pour vider les enregistrements de 5 colonnes sur 10


Sujet :

Requêtes et SQL.

  1. #1
    Membre régulier
    Profil pro
    Inscrit en
    Janvier 2008
    Messages
    460
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Janvier 2008
    Messages : 460
    Points : 71
    Points
    71
    Par défaut Comment faire pour vider les enregistrements de 5 colonnes sur 10
    Bonjour,

    Je voudrais savoir comment faire pour vider les enregistrements de 5 colonnes sur 10.

    Détail : j'ai une table "TCI" alimenté par le biais d une requête MàJ mais des fois j 'ai besoin de vider tout les enregistrements de cette table comment faire ?

  2. #2
    Invité
    Invité(e)
    Par défaut
    Bonjour

    Pour essayer par une requête de mise à jour qui remplacera les données par un vide.

    Par exemple, la ligne suivante enlève les données du champ dte2 de la table Table2.


    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    UPDATE Table2 SET Table2.dte2 = "";
    Philippe

  3. #3
    Modérateur

    Homme Profil pro
    Inscrit en
    Octobre 2005
    Messages
    15 353
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Canada

    Informations forums :
    Inscription : Octobre 2005
    Messages : 15 353
    Points : 23 819
    Points
    23 819
    Par défaut
    Si tu veux vider toute une table de ses enregistrements :

    Code sql : Sélectionner tout - Visualiser dans une fenêtre à part
    delete [TaTable].* from [TaTable];

    Si tu veux mettre à blanc certains champs TOUT en conservant les enregistrements : voir la réponse de Philippe JOCHMANS.

    A+

  4. #4
    Responsable Arduino et Systèmes Embarqués


    Avatar de f-leb
    Homme Profil pro
    Enseignant
    Inscrit en
    Janvier 2009
    Messages
    12 737
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 53
    Localisation : France, Sarthe (Pays de la Loire)

    Informations professionnelles :
    Activité : Enseignant

    Informations forums :
    Inscription : Janvier 2009
    Messages : 12 737
    Points : 57 501
    Points
    57 501
    Billets dans le blog
    42
    Par défaut
    bonjour,

    Citation Envoyé par Philippe JOCHMANS Voir le message
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    UPDATE Table2 SET Table2.dte2 = "";
    éventuellement si le champ dte2 est de type texte, sinon:
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    UPDATE Table2 SET Table2.dte2 = null;

Discussions similaires

  1. Réponses: 1
    Dernier message: 29/04/2006, 22h08
  2. Comment faire pour montrer les procédures qui démarrent ave
    Par zoltix dans le forum MS SQL Server
    Réponses: 3
    Dernier message: 07/02/2006, 08h12
  3. Réponses: 4
    Dernier message: 05/01/2006, 09h01
  4. Réponses: 2
    Dernier message: 23/11/2005, 16h30
  5. Réponses: 2
    Dernier message: 13/11/2005, 18h03

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o